I've been thinking about using one of these two in my games, but i'm stumped as to what one would be better.

Azog: A melee beatstick. With the White Warg, he seems like he'd be mean, knockdown and 3+ to wound enemy heroes is pretty brutal (also, would his two handed weapon stack with the 3+ to wound?),but its a pricey combination.

Bolg: Another melee beatstick. Tougher than Azog, but he gains buffs from killing enemy infantry, which he is very good at.

I'm personally leaning towards Azog as I tend to have problems putting down enemy heroes like Aragon or Boromir. The Hunter Orcs seem pretty good at killing basic models, which makes Bolg a bit redundant.

The way I see it, Bolg wants to go kill 10 warriors then start going after heroes. Azog is a torpedo to send into your opponent's best heroes from the beginning.

Bolg eventually becomes better than Azog, but it requires the full 10 kills. And yes, I would assume that a 3+ to wound stacks with an ability that lets you add one to the number you roll to wound.

If you take Azog, though, definitely take his White Warg. Another 3 might and will are just well worth 50 points.

It's an interesting situation with the "hero" mount. I don't know of any other precedence for it in SBG. Considering the rule of thumb for all other situations is that you may elect to use any or all of a mount's profile in a fight, I wonder if it might hold true here as well?

For example: Use the Warg's Fate if he's hit while still mounted. Use his Might to call an Heroic Combat while Azog's still mounted (assuming there's nothing in his profile saying he can't call HC).

Of course, if you can't tap his MWF while he's serving as a Mount, I imagine you can at least use them to modify the roll to stay on the table when the dismount does occur.

I know that a rider can spend Will for his mount, so it follows that it goes both ways. Since a Nazgul can spend might to modify a to wound roll for his Fell Beast, it follows that the White Warg can spend might for Azog. However, neither can use the others Fate. I personally am going to use them as a hero hunter to take out the baddest heros in the enemy army, then once they're gone, split them up to butcher some warriors. The thing about Azog is that he doesn't have the potential of Bolg. Terror would have been a nice addition to his profile.
